AI Obstacle Avoidance
The top robot vacuums have sensors that aid them in avoiding obstacles and navigate around the home. These include distance sensors that emit laser beams and measure how long it takes for the light to bounce off walls and furniture to create an image of the space. This lets the robot detect and steer clear of objects, ensuring a collision-free cleaning process.
Other robots employ 3D Time of Flight (ToF) imaging to scan the surrounding area and detect obstacles. This technology is utilized in smart home camera systems and Best Affordable Robot Vacuum operates by sending a series of light pulses that are later examined to determine the height and size of the object. It is not as precise as other mapping techniques and could be unable to distinguish reflective or transparent surfaces.
Certain robotic cleaners use, in addition to traditional sensors to identify and avoid obstacles, employ advanced AI. ECOVACS robots, for example come with AIVI 3D that can accurately detect obstacles to ensure a smooth and safe cleaning process. This sophisticated software can operate in darkness, allowing users to enjoy a clean home overnight or while watching television.
Another way robotic cleaners can get around obstacles is by using monocular or binocular vision to take pictures and analyze them to understand what they are. This feature helps the robot avoid running into items, like furniture legs or toys, and could help you avoid a amount of trouble. This type of obstacle detection isn't as effective as laser or 3D imaging, however, and can result in the robot becoming stuck in furniture or missing areas of the room.

Suction Power
Suction power is measured in Pascals. It is the force that holds the bristles or rollers of the robot to the floor. This allows them to grab dirt and then direct it to the dustbin. It is important to evaluate your cleaning needs and evaluate models on the basis of suction strength before committing to purchase.
For the majority of homes at least 2,500 Pa is enough to maintain floors that have an assortment of soft and hard flooring types. If you have a lot of carpets, you should consider a premium model with up to 11000 Pa of power.
The majority of robotic vacuum cleaner comparison vacuum cleaners that are budget-friendly come with two or three rotors that create a vacuum-like suction to pick up hair, dirt and other particles on the floor. They then deposit it in their trash bin. These models are best suited for vacuuming hard floors as well as low-pile area rugs. The more expensive models include additional brushes that do not tangle to get into crevices and corners.
If you have various types of flooring in your home, you should choose a model with different suction levels. They will automatically adjust to the type of surface. This lets you adjust the suction level according to your individual needs and safeguard your floors from wear and tear.
A self-emptying robot vacuum that has a large dustbin is another way to reduce the amount of dust that is inside your robot floor cleaner. They empty their internal dustbins after every cleaning cycle to avoid the buildup of hair that is tangled and other particles that hinder the performance of the machine.
Remember that higher suction power vacuum cleaners require longer run times for each cleaning session. However they also accumulate debris more quickly and fill their dustbins more frequently. It's important to weigh the benefits of the power of cleaning and the battery's runtime, sound, and dustbin refilling frequency.
